Oil prices plunged late Monday after President Donald Trump signaled that the Iran war may be nearing an end. International benchmark Brent crude and US West Texas Intermediate futures were down about 10% at 9:48 p.m. ET, trading at $89.13 and $85.78 a barrel, respectively. Both had fallen as much as 11% earlier in the day.
